Korean Tea Ceremony
a meditative ritual of presence, grace, and quiet connection
Service Description
Rooted in centuries of tradition, the Korean tea ceremony (다례, Darye) is a meditative ritual of presence, grace, and quiet connection. In this gentle practice, we slow down to share tea mindfully—inviting beauty, intention, and stillness into each gesture. Guided by the spirit of “living art,” this ceremony honors the wisdom of our ancestors and the sacred simplicity of gathering. You’ll be served seasonal Korean teas alongside mindful silence, soft music, or poetry. The session becomes a space to breathe, reflect, and return to your center. Whether held as a private ritual or part of a group offering, the Korean tea ceremony is an invitation to be nourished—by the earth, the tea, and your own presence.
